- On January 25 at Magic Kingdom, Maneloveg was selected as the U.S. Armed Forces Representative of the Day and took part in the sunset Flag Retreat in Town Square.
- The 101-year-old served in the U.S. Army’s 106th Infantry Division, was wounded in the Battle of the Bulge, and later received a Purple Heart.
- He celebrated with his family by touring Main Street, U.S.A., posing at Cinderella Castle, and enjoying special viewing of the Festival of Fantasy Parade.
- Mickey, Minnie, and other characters acknowledged him during the parade, and he and his daughter Susan thanked Disney, with Maneloveg calling the day better than any wish he had ever had.
- Disney notes the parks’ daily veteran tributes dating to 1955 at Disneyland and 1971 at Magic Kingdom, and it is promoting 250th-anniversary offerings including a Soarin’ Across America return at EPCOT and Disney California Adventure this summer.
